Intentional Communication and Graphic Symbol Use by Students with Severe Intellectual Disability.
Stephenson, Jennifer; Linfoot, Ken
International Journal of Disability, Development and Education, v43 n2 p147-65 1996
This article discusses communicative intent in persons with severe intellectual disability in the context of intervention studies reporting the acquisition of graphic symbol use. The article reviews communicative intent as formulated within psycholinguistic models of language acquisition which emphasize pragmatics and the functions of communicative behavior in social contexts and relates them to the development of graphic symbol use.
